Back-End Development Training Courses Overview (Online/Offline)

Master the art of server-side development with our Back-End Development Training Courses, covering Python, Java, and .NET. This course is designed to equip you with the skills to build robust, scalable, and efficient server-side applications.

Start with Python, where you'll learn to create powerful back-end systems using frameworks like Django and Flask. You’ll gain experience in handling databases, APIs, and server-side logic for dynamic web applications.

Move on to Java, mastering this powerful, enterprise-grade language for building high-performance web applications. Learn how to utilize Java frameworks such as Spring for creating secure, scalable back-end architectures.

Finally, delve into .NET to develop enterprise-level back-end solutions using Microsoft’s powerful framework. You’ll explore how to build and deploy applications with C#, focusing on high efficiency and reliability.

Our training is available in flexible online and offline formats and includes hands-on projects to give you real-world experience. Whether you’re a beginner or looking to expand your knowledge, this course will prepare you to excel as a back-end developer.

Join us to build your expertise in back-end technologies and create the engines that power modern web applications.

Training Image
Online Training

INR 25000

INR 20000

One to One Training

INR 25000

INR 22000

Python Training Courses Overview (Online/Offline)

Our Python Language Training Course is designed to provide you with a comprehensive understanding of one of the most versatile and widely-used programming languages today. Whether you're starting from scratch or looking to deepen your knowledge, this course covers everything from basic syntax to advanced concepts, ensuring you become proficient in Python.

With flexible online and offline learning options, you'll gain practical experience in various aspects of Python, including data analysis, web development, automation, and more. The course features hands-on projects that enable you to apply your skills in real-world scenarios, preparing you for diverse industry challenges.

Our experienced trainers offer personalized guidance, providing one-on-one support to enhance your learning experience and ensure a thorough understanding of the material. The well-structured syllabus, combined with project work and regular evaluations, guarantees a solid foundation in Python, equipping you for roles in software development, data science, and beyond.

Whether your goal is to develop applications, analyze data, or automate tasks, our Python course will empower you with the skills and confidence to excel. Enroll today with Way to Code Technologies LLP and take your Python skills to the next level.

What is Python?

Python is a versatile, high-level programming language known for its simplicity and readability. Developed by Guido van Rossum and first released in 1991, Python is widely used across various domains, including web development, data science, automation, and more.


Key Features of Python:

  • Readability and Simplicity: Python's syntax is designed to be clear and easy to understand, making it accessible for beginners and efficient for experienced developers.
  • Interpreted Language: Python code is executed line-by-line by an interpreter, which simplifies debugging and development.
  • Dynamic Typing: Variables in Python are dynamically typed, which allows for flexible and concise code without explicit type declarations.
  • Extensive Standard Library: Python's standard library includes a wide range of modules and packages that facilitate tasks like file handling, internet communication, and data manipulation.
  • Multi-Paradigm: Python supports multiple programming paradigms, including object-oriented, functional, and procedural programming, providing flexibility in coding styles.

Common Applications of Python:

  • Web Development: Python's frameworks, such as Django and Flask, are popular for building robust web applications.
  • Data Science and Machine Learning: Libraries like NumPy, Pandas, and TensorFlow make Python a leading choice for data analysis and machine learning tasks.
  • Automation: Python is frequently used for writing scripts to automate repetitive tasks and processes.
  • Software Development: Python is used in developing a wide range of software applications, from simple scripts to complex systems.
  • Education: Due to its simplicity, Python is widely used as an introductory language in computer science education.

Python's balance of simplicity and power, along with its extensive ecosystem, makes it a versatile language suitable for various programming needs and applications.

Java Training Courses Overview (Online/Offline)

Our Java Language Training Course is designed to provide you with a thorough understanding of one of the most powerful and widely-used programming languages in the industry. Whether you're a beginner or looking to enhance your skills, this course covers everything from basic syntax to advanced concepts, ensuring you become proficient in Java.

With flexible online and offline learning options, you'll gain practical experience in various aspects of Java, including object-oriented programming, data structures, multithreading, and more. The course features hands-on projects that enable you to apply your skills in real-world scenarios, preparing you for diverse industry challenges.

Our experienced trainers offer personalized guidance, providing one-on-one support to enhance your learning experience and ensure a thorough understanding of the material. The well-structured syllabus, combined with project work and regular assessments, guarantees a solid foundation in Java, equipping you for roles in software development, web development, and beyond.

Whether your goal is to develop applications, build enterprise solutions, or work on Android development, our Java course will empower you with the skills and confidence to succeed. Enroll today with Way to Code Technologies LLP and advance your Java expertise.

What is Java?

Java is a widely-used, high-level programming language known for its portability, scalability, and robust performance. Developed by James Gosling and released by Sun Microsystems in 1995, Java has become a cornerstone of enterprise software development and is used across a wide range of applications.


Key Features of Java:

  • Object-Oriented Programming (OOP): Java is designed around OOP principles such as classes, inheritance, polymorphism, and encapsulation, which help create modular, maintainable, and reusable code.
  • Platform Independence: Java applications are compiled into bytecode, which runs on the Java Virtual Machine (JVM). This allows Java programs to be written once and run anywhere (WORA), making it highly portable across different operating systems.
  • Automatic Memory Management: Java features automatic garbage collection, which helps manage memory allocation and deallocation, reducing the risk of memory leaks and improving application stability.
  • Rich Standard Library: Java provides a comprehensive standard library that includes APIs for networking, input/output operations, data structures, graphical user interfaces, and more.
  • Multithreading Support: Java has built-in support for multithreading, allowing concurrent execution of multiple threads, which is essential for building high-performance and responsive applications.

Common Applications of Java:

  • Enterprise Applications: Java is extensively used in building large-scale enterprise systems, including web servers, application servers, and enterprise resource planning (ERP) systems.
  • Android Development: Java is one of the primary languages for developing Android applications, supported by the Android SDK and development tools.
  • Web Development: Java frameworks like Spring and JavaServer Faces (JSF) are used for creating dynamic web applications and services.
  • Financial Services: Java's performance and reliability make it a popular choice for developing trading platforms, financial systems, and other high-transaction applications.
  • Embedded Systems: Java is used in various embedded systems and devices due to its portability and scalability.

Java's combination of robust features, portability, and extensive ecosystem makes it a versatile language suitable for a wide range of development needs, from enterprise applications to mobile and web development.

ASP.NET Training Courses Overview (Online/Offline)

Our ASP.NET Language Training Course is designed to equip you with in-depth knowledge of one of the most powerful frameworks for building web applications. Whether you are a beginner or looking to enhance your skills, this course covers everything from basic web development to advanced ASP.NET MVC techniques, making you proficient in creating robust and scalable applications.

With flexible online and offline learning options, you’ll gain hands-on experience with essential topics like web forms, ASP.NET Core, Entity Framework, Razor pages, and more. The course includes real-time projects that allow you to apply your skills in practical scenarios, ensuring you're ready for real-world challenges in web development.

You’ll learn from experienced trainers who provide personalized guidance, ensuring individualized attention and deeper understanding. Our strong syllabus, combined with project work and regular assessments, ensures you build a solid foundation in ASP.NET, preparing you for roles in full stack web development and enterprise-level application development.

Whether you're aiming to develop web applications, create enterprise solutions, or work with cloud-based platforms, our ASP.NET course will give you the skills and confidence to succeed. Join us today at Way to Code Technologies LLP and take the next step towards mastering ASP.NET.

What is ASP.NET?

ASP.NET is a web application framework developed by Microsoft for building dynamic websites, web applications, and services. First released in 2002 as part of the .NET framework, ASP.NET is widely used in enterprise environments and offers powerful tools for developers to create scalable, secure, and high-performance web applications.


Key Features of ASP.NET:

  • MVC Architecture: ASP.NET supports the Model-View-Controller (MVC) pattern, which separates application logic, user interface, and input control, enabling clean and modular development.
  • Cross-Platform Support: With the release of ASP.NET Core, the framework became cross-platform, allowing developers to build and deploy applications on Windows, Linux, and macOS.
  • Server-Side Development: ASP.NET is a server-side framework, meaning the code runs on the server, allowing the generation of dynamic web pages before they are sent to the browser.
  • Razor Pages: A simplified web development approach using Razor syntax, which combines HTML and C# to create dynamic, data-driven web pages with minimal effort.
  • Integrated Security: ASP.NET comes with built-in security features, such as authentication (including OAuth, OpenID, and JWT) and authorization, making it easier to build secure applications.
  • Rich Tooling and Libraries: ASP.NET integrates seamlessly with Microsoft Visual Studio, providing advanced debugging, testing, and deployment tools, as well as a rich ecosystem of libraries for various needs like data access, caching, and dependency injection.

Common Applications of ASP.NET:

  • Enterprise Web Applications: ASP.NET is widely used for developing large-scale, secure enterprise-level applications, including customer relationship management (CRM) systems and enterprise resource planning (ERP) systems.
  • E-Commerce Websites: ASP.NET provides scalability and performance, making it a preferred choice for building high-traffic e-commerce platforms.
  • RESTful APIs and Web Services: ASP.NET Web API allows developers to build RESTful services and APIs, which can serve mobile applications, IoT devices, and other clients.
  • Real-Time Applications: Using SignalR, ASP.NET enables real-time communication between servers and clients, making it ideal for chat applications, live notifications, and online gaming.
  • Cloud-Ready Applications: ASP.NET Core is optimized for building cloud-based web apps, offering seamless integration with cloud services like Microsoft Azure.

ASP.NET is known for its robustness, scalability, and strong support for enterprise-grade applications. With the flexibility provided by ASP.NET Core, it is now more versatile than ever, capable of running on various platforms and catering to modern web development needs.

Master Your Craft

Begin Your Learning Journey Now!
Title

Upcoming Batch Schedule - Join Today!

Flexible Timing

Learn at your own pace with schedules that fit your lifestyle.

No Batching System

Start your journey today—no need to wait for a batch to fill up.

Exclusive One-to-One Sessions Available

For those seeking a personalized learning experience.

Small Batch Size

Maximum of 4 students per batch, ensuring focused attention.

Non-Working Hour Batches

Available from 6 AM to 9 AM & 8 PM to 12 AM with an extra charges for added flexibility.

Personal Focus

We prioritize your learning with a personalized approach.

Certification Training Course

At Way to Code Technologies LLP, we offer globally recognized certifications that bolster your career and validate your skillset. Whether you're a beginner entering the tech world or an experienced professional aiming to upskill, our program provides the perfect balance of theoretical knowledge and practical, hands-on experience to prepare you for real-world challenges.

Way to Code Technologies Certificate

Our certifications are highly valued by top-tier companies globally, enhancing your resume and opening doors to high-demand job opportunities. Certification is awarded only after successful completion of our comprehensive training, which includes real-time projects designed to showcase your practical abilities.

Each course culminates in a real-world project, reviewed by our industry experts. If needed, we provide full support with feedback, doubt clarification, and additional resources to help you achieve success.

Our curriculum is aligned with the latest industry trends and technologies, ensuring that you're learning up-to-date tools and best practices. Whether your goal is mastering traditional or cutting-edge technologies, we have flexible learning options to suit your career aspirations.

With Way to Code Technologies LLP, you don’t just earn a certificate; you gain the expertise and confidence to elevate your career. Our dedicated support and updated syllabus ensure you’re prepared to excel in today’s competitive job market.

Your Journey to Success Starts Here

Learn Something New Today!

Key Features

  • 100% Practical Training
  • Industrial Expert Trainer
  • Live Projects
  • Life Time Free Validity
  • One-to-One Training
  • Limited Students Batch
  • Flexible Timing
  • 24*7 Live Support
  • Internship Experience Letter
  • Interview Preparation
  • 100% Placement Assistance
  • Online Training Available

Reviews

I had an amazing learning experience with Way to Code Technologies! The instructors are highly knowledgeable and provide excellent guidance throughout the course. The practical approach, combined with real-world examples, helped me grasp complex topics easily. The training programs are well-structured and cater to both beginners and advanced learners. I highly recommend Way to Code for anyone looking to build or enhance their IT skills

R

Ria Sorathiya

★★★★★

Way to Code Technologies truly caters to students from all backgrounds, including non-IT fields like mine. The training was well-paced, and I never felt overwhelmed, even with no prior knowledge of coding. The practical projects and real-world examples helped me understand how to apply the concepts in my own field. Great place for anyone wanting to learn new skills!

M

Meet Desai

★★★★★

I enrolled in the Full Stack Development course at Way to Code, and it exceeded my expectations! The mentors were incredibly supportive, and the hands-on projects allowed me to apply what I learned right away. I now feel confident in my coding skills and ready to take on real-world challenges. Highly recommend for anyone serious about building a career in tech!

D

Dhruvanshi Vastani

★★★★★

Outstanding experience way to code! Their commitment to excellence is evident in both their services and internship programs. The IT courses offered are comprehensive, and the knowledgeable staff ensures a great learning atmosphere. Definitely a top choice in the industry!

H

Het Chaudhari

★★★★★

As a non-IT student, I was initially nervous about learning technical skills, but Way to Code Technologies made everything so easy to understand! The instructors broke down complex topics into simple, digestible lessons, and I felt supported throughout the course. I now feel confident in my ability to use technology in my career. Highly recommended for anyone from a non-technical background!

A

Aditya Rathod

★★★★★

Get Ahead in Your Career

Start Gaining New Skills Today!

Frequently asked Question

What certifications do you offer after course completion?

Upon completing the course and a real-world project, you'll receive a globally recognized certification. This credential validates your skills and expertise in the technology learned. It enhances your professional profile and marketability.

Why should I choose Way to Code Technologies for my training?

We provide an industry-relevant curriculum with expert trainers and hands-on projects. Our flexible learning options and up-to-date materials ensure a comprehensive training experience. We prepare you effectively for real-world challenges.

Do you provide placement assistance after completing the course?

Yes, we offer placement assistance, including resume building, interview preparation, and job connections. We leverage our network to help you secure employment. Our support is designed to facilitate your transition into the job market.

What is the expertise of the trainers at Way to Code Technologies?

Our trainers are industry experts with extensive practical experience. They provide up-to-date knowledge and real-world insights. Their expertise ensures you receive high-quality, relevant training.

What if I miss a live training session?

All sessions are recorded, and you'll have access to these recordings. You can review missed content at your convenience. Trainers are also available for additional support as needed.

What are the different modes of training available?

We offer both online and offline training options. You can choose between live virtual classes or in-person sessions. This flexibility accommodates different learning preferences and schedules.

Are the courses updated to match current industry standards?

Yes, our courses are regularly updated to reflect the latest industry trends and technologies. This ensures that you are learning the most relevant and current skills. Staying up-to-date helps you remain competitive in the job market.

Can I get a demo session before enrolling in the course?

Yes, we offer a free demo session to help you understand our teaching approach and course content. This allows you to experience our learning environment before making a commitment. It’s a great way to ensure the course meets your expectations.

Do you offer corporate training or team discounts?

Yes, we provide customized corporate training programs and group discounts. We tailor the training to fit organizational needs and offer savings for multiple participants. This makes upskilling teams more cost-effective.

How do I receive support if I have questions during the course?

You’ll have access to dedicated support throughout the course. You can contact trainers, support staff, or use our online helpdesk for assistance. We ensure you get the help you need to succeed.

What payment options do you offer?

We offer flexible payment options, including credit/debit cards, online transfers, and no-cost EMI plans. Additionally, we provide a discount for one-time payments. These options make the course more affordable and accessible.

Quick Enquiry

Title